Prime Minister Narendra Modi today said Odisha will soon become the epitome of industrial development that no one ever imagined. The Prime Minister said Odisha is the land of new aspiration, opportunity, and optimism that will lead all investors and industrialists to reach the pinnacle of success, and he has come to Odisha to give a guarantee for this, and it is ‘Modi’s Guarantee’. Inaugurating the ‘Utkarsh Odisha, Make in Odisha Conclave-2025’ at Janata Maidan in Bhubaneswar this morning, the Prime Minister said Odisha has always been a priority for him, as he had visited about 30 times since becoming the Prime Minister of the country. He said the role of Odisha in making India the third largest economy in the world is very significant. Mr. Modi said he has faith in the capacity of Odisha and its people to make the state one of the fastest-growing economies among all the states.

The Prime Minister also called upon the investors and industrialists to support MSMEs, startups by youths, and research and innovation activities in Odisha, and his government will provide all support to them. Chief Minister of Odisha Mohan Charan Majhi, Union Ministers Dharmendra Pradhan and Aswini Baishnaw, and several other dignitaries remained present at the inaugural function.

Odisha hopes to attract investment exceeding 5 lakh crore rupees, with job creation projected to increase by 3.5 lakh after the two-day-long conclave in which about 100 MoUs are likely to be signed between the Odisha state government and investors. More than 7,000 delegates, including envoys, investors, and industrialists from India and 12 other countries, have been participating in the business conclave.
